It’s an extraordinary pairing: a profoundly personal, handwritten letter by the legendary artist himself, alongside an original Type 1 photograph. Now, if you’re not deep into vintage photography, you might be asking, “What’s so special about a Type 1?” Well, my friend, it’s the gold standard. A Type 1 photo is printed directly from the original negative, right during the period the image was taken. It’s the purest, most authentic capture of that moment in time, untouched by subsequent reproductions.
